【组件的深入理解】
本帖最后由 书香 于 2023-5-21 22:42 编辑上节课我们已经知道了软件大概是如何开发的了
1:添加各种组件
2:确定动作
3:在动作里写代码
组件你可以理解成一个中介,让我们和代码之间去沟通,组件有2个特性
1:读写性,比如登录某个软件
你在“编辑框”这个组件中输入账号密码,代码就可以读到你在这个组件中输入的内容
登录失败,会有提示,这便是代码让“标签”组件写出文本让你看到
2:响应性
比如“按钮”组件的被单击,“编辑框”组件的内容被改变等等,我们在对应的响应(j监视动作)里面去编写代码
【组件有多少种】
无数种
比如:
1:“编辑框”的主要作用就是记录输入的内容
2:“按钮”的作用是为了让人们去单击(告诉设备开始执行代码)
3:“下拉列表框”是为了让人们选择内容(比如选择登录哪个账号)
所以,组件有无数种,只要有需求就可以去开发,每个编程语言官方都有自身的组件,我们这里称为“官方库”,有的人觉得“官方库”不好用或不好看,所以会优化或重新编写,这里称为“第3方库”
(我们的课程不研究组件如何封装,基本都够用了,觉得丑后期有美化课程的)
(点击返回课程目录:https://www.52hb.com/thread-58658-1-1.html)
学习学习 学一下这篇文章 这个好,前来学习。 通过大佬的这番话,对组件有了深入的理解,感谢大佬
页:
[1]